The classic baguette is a staple of French cuisine, known for its crispy crust and soft, airy interior. This bread is perfect for sandwiches, toast, or just enjoying with a bit of butter and jam. Baking it at home gives you a chance to experience that authentic French bakery feel right in your own kitchen.

  • 3 ½ c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 ½ cups warm water
  • 2 teaspoons salt
  • 1 teaspoon sugar
  • 1 packet (2 ¼ teaspoons) active dry yeast

The baguette is special because of its iconic shape and texture that many find hard to resist. The crispy crust gives way to a fluffy interior, making it a true delight. Plus, the process of shaping the dough into those long, slender loaves feels almost artistic. When you pull a fresh baguette from the oven, the satisfaction is simply unbeatable!

While not strictly French, focaccia has found its way into many French kitchens and is adored for its rich olive oil flavor and delightful herb toppings. This flatbread is soft and chewy, making it perfect for dipping in olive oil or serving alongside soups and salads. It’s a versatile bread that’s great for sharing at gatherings.

  • 4 cups all-purpose flour
  • 2 cups warm water
  • 1 packet (2 ¼ teaspoons) active dry yeast
  • 1 tablespoon sugar
  • 1 tablespoon salt
  • ½ cup olive oil
  • Fresh herbs (like rosemary or thyme)

What makes focaccia so beloved is its rustic charm and the way it can be customized with various toppings. You can sprinkle it with sea salt, add olives, or even layer in roasted vegetables. The best part is how easy it is to make, requiring minimal kneading and just a bit of patience while it rises. Once baked, the golden crust with those crispy edges is simply irresistible!

This country-style bread is hearty and flavorful, often made with a mix of white and whole wheat flour. The crust is thick and crunchy, while the inside is soft, making it perfect for thick slices topped with cheese or spreads. It’s a fantastic choice for those cozy evenings at home with family and friends.

  • 3 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up whole wheat flour
  • 1 ½ cups warm water
  • 1 packet (2 ¼ teaspoons) active dry yeast
  • 1 tablespoon salt

Pain de Campagne stands out because of its rustic appearance and robust flavor. It often has a slightly tangy taste thanks to the fermentation process, which many find delightful. This bread is perfect for making sandwiches or serving with a hearty soup, and it’s a real crowd-pleaser at any dinner table. Plus, the satisfaction of crafting this beautiful loaf from scratch is truly rewarding!

While traditionally a Jewish bread, Challah has made its way into French bakeries and is loved for its rich, eggy texture and slightly sweet flavor. The braided shape adds a touch of elegance, making it perfect for special occasions or a delightful breakfast treat. Served warm, it pairs wonderfully with butter or jam.

  • 4 cups all-purpose flour
  • ½ cup sugar
  • 1 cup warm water
  • 3 large eggs
  • 1 packet (2 ¼ teaspoons) active dry yeast
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• ¼ cup vegetable oil

Challah is special not just for its taste but for the rituals associated with it, making it a beloved part of many gatherings. The soft, fluffy texture and golden crust are simply irresistible. Plus, the process of braiding the dough is fun and allows for creativity in how you shape it. Whether enjoyed on its own or transformed into French toast, this bread brings a touch of sweetness to any meal!
